Spheron vs Vercel vs Fleek is mainly a comparison decision for founders, developers, and Web3 teams choosing where to deploy frontend apps, static sites, and decentralized products in 2026. The short version: Vercel is usually best for mainstream frontend velocity, Fleek is stronger for Web3-native hosting and edge delivery, and Spheron fits teams that want decentralized infrastructure with a more crypto-aligned deployment stack.
Quick Answer
- Vercel is the strongest option for Next.js apps, fast iteration, preview deployments, and polished developer experience.
- Fleek is better for Web3 projects that want IPFS-based hosting, decentralized delivery, and domain-level crypto-native workflows.
- Spheron is best for teams building on decentralized compute and storage rails rather than relying fully on Web2 cloud platforms.
- Vercel works well for SaaS, AI apps, landing pages, and developer tools, but it is not designed as a crypto-native infrastructure layer.
- Fleek and Spheron make more sense when censorship resistance, wallet-friendly ecosystems, or decentralized hosting strategy matter.
- The right choice depends on framework fit, decentralization needs, team skill level, and whether your product is Web2-first or Web3-native.
Quick Verdict
If you are building a typical startup app, Vercel wins on speed and DX. If you are building a crypto-native frontend, token app, NFT platform, DePIN dashboard, or decentralized site, Fleek or Spheron may be the better strategic fit.
Right now in 2026, this matters more because teams are no longer choosing hosting only on performance. They are also choosing based on stack identity, data control, resilience, wallet integration, and infrastructure risk.

Key Differences That Actually Matter
1. Developer experience vs infrastructure philosophy
Vercel is optimized for shipping fast. Git-based deploys, preview environments, framework integration, and edge tooling are where it stands out.
Spheron and Fleek are not just “hosting alternatives.” They represent a different infrastructure philosophy: build on decentralized rails where possible.
This works when your product story, trust model, or user base already lives in crypto. It fails when your team really just wants easy frontend hosting and has no operational reason to go decentralized.
2. Web2 frontend workflows vs Web3-native workflows
If your app is a standard React, Next.js, or SaaS product with auth, APIs, and dashboards, Vercel usually reduces friction.
If your product includes wallet connections, on-chain metadata, token pages, NFT media, IPFS content addressing, or decentralized app distribution, then Fleek and Spheron become more strategically relevant.
3. Performance is not the only metric
Many teams compare these tools only on page load speed. That is incomplete.
In real startup decisions, the bigger questions are:
- Do you need content permanence or content addressing?
- Do you want to reduce reliance on a single centralized platform?
- Will investors, partners, or users expect a crypto-native infrastructure posture?
- Will your developers lose time fighting unfamiliar tooling?
When to Choose Spheron
Spheron makes the most sense for startups that want decentralized infrastructure to be part of the actual product strategy, not just a marketing label.
Best-fit scenarios
- DePIN products that want infrastructure alignment across compute, storage, and delivery
- Web3 apps where decentralization is part of user trust
- Teams experimenting with decentralized compute marketplaces
- Projects that want to avoid over-dependence on AWS-style hosting stacks
Why it works
Spheron is attractive when the infrastructure layer itself matters to your brand, economics, or ecosystem positioning. For example, if you are building a crypto-native product for developers or protocol communities, hosting on a decentralized-aligned platform can reinforce credibility.
When it fails
It can be the wrong choice for teams that need ultra-smooth enterprise frontend workflows, low onboarding friction, or heavy reliance on mature ecosystem integrations. If your engineers are not comfortable debugging beyond standard cloud patterns, the operational overhead can outweigh the narrative value.
Who should not use it
- Non-technical founders needing the fastest path to launch
- Startups building conventional B2B SaaS products
- Teams whose customers do not care about infrastructure decentralization
When to Choose Vercel
Vercel is still the default winner for many startups because it solves the thing most early-stage teams actually need: ship product fast without babysitting infrastructure.
Best-fit scenarios
- Next.js applications
- SaaS platforms with frequent frontend iteration
- AI products shipping dashboards, onboarding flows, and landing pages
- Developer tools companies that need preview deployments and team collaboration
Why it works
Vercel removes deployment friction. Product teams can move from pull request to preview to production quickly. That is especially important when growth, SEO pages, onboarding, and UX testing matter more than infrastructure ideology.
When it fails
Vercel becomes less ideal when your app needs a strong decentralized story, IPFS-native delivery, or reduced dependence on a centralized vendor. It can also become expensive or constraining if you scale into unusual workloads that do not map cleanly to its intended frontend model.
Who should not use it
- Teams that need decentralized hosting as a core requirement
- Crypto-native products where community trust depends on infrastructure choices
- Projects that want storage and delivery tied closely to blockchain-native workflows
When to Choose Fleek
Fleek sits in a strong middle position for Web3 teams. It is more crypto-native than Vercel, but often more accessible than deeper infrastructure-first alternatives.
Best-fit scenarios
- NFT platforms and galleries using decentralized storage concepts
- DAO sites and token community portals
- Static or semi-dynamic Web3 apps that benefit from IPFS delivery
- Teams that want decentralized hosting without building everything from scratch
Why it works
Fleek fits startups that want practical Web3 hosting rather than a pure cloud workflow. It is especially useful when your frontend distribution model and your product identity are connected.
When it fails
If your app depends heavily on advanced server-side logic, highly custom edge behavior, or the deepest frontend deployment ergonomics, you may still prefer Vercel. If you need broader decentralized compute ambition, you may lean toward Spheron instead.

Pricing and Cost Thinking
Pricing changes often, so founders should check current plans directly. But the smarter way to think about cost is not just monthly hosting.
Compare these three cost layers:
- Engineering time cost
- Vendor dependency cost
- Strategic mismatch cost
A common mistake is choosing a cheaper Web3 host, then losing weeks in developer friction. Another common mistake is choosing Vercel because it is easy, then later realizing your protocol community expects stronger decentralization.
Expert Insight: Ali Hajimohamadi
Most founders compare hosting like it is a DevOps purchase. It is not. For Web3 startups, it is often a trust decision disguised as a deployment decision.
The contrarian take: the “best DX” option is not always the best business option. If your product claims decentralization but your core user experience depends on a centralized frontend platform, sophisticated users notice that mismatch fast.
The rule I use is simple: if infrastructure credibility influences user trust, choose the platform that preserves narrative consistency, even if it is slightly less convenient. If it does not influence trust, optimize for speed and team output.
Common Founder Mistakes
Choosing based only on branding
Some teams pick Spheron or Fleek because “decentralized” sounds aligned. That fails when the actual app needs high-speed iteration, A/B testing, SSR workflows, and standard SaaS ops.
Choosing based only on developer convenience
Some crypto teams default to Vercel because everyone knows it. That works early, but it can weaken product credibility if decentralization is central to the brand or token community.
Ignoring future architecture direction
Your hosting choice affects more than deploys. It influences how you think about storage, content addressing, edge distribution, wallet-based access, and protocol integration.
